How they compare
Italy currently reports 25,991 kilowatt-hours per person against 25,219 kilowatt-hours per person in Serbia, a difference of 772 kilowatt-hours per person.
The two have swapped places 4 times across 19 shared years of data; in 2006 it was Italy ahead.
Italy ranks 71st and Serbia ranks 72nd of 218 countries.
Italy has averaged higher in every one of the 3 decades both report.
Head to head by decade
| Decade | Italy | Serbia |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 34,869 kilowatt-hours per person | 24,441 kilowatt-hours per person | 10,428 kilowatt-hours per person | Italy |
| 2010s | 29,448 kilowatt-hours per person | 24,349 kilowatt-hours per person | 5,098 kilowatt-hours per person | Italy |
| 2020s | 26,606 kilowatt-hours per person | 26,103 kilowatt-hours per person | 502.8 kilowatt-hours per person | Italy |
Averages of every year both report within each decade.
